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
45 460055119 74060
343 59459 7926194927
343 59459 7926194927
5752251762 8376 29
All about undefined
Interested in learning more?
343 59459 7926194927
5752251762 8376 29
See more
6558 561
93184210 90233 3225
See more
57902993713 716 8475170456
752 03600775 87852517
See more